Here are some productive activities that can provide meaning and satisfaction after entering retirement.

1. Become a Mentor or Counselor

After retirement, many people have a wealth of knowledge and experience that can be shared with the younger generation. If you are interested, start identifying areas of interest or expertise that you would like to share with others. Whether it is related to your previous career, a hobby, or a new interest you developed during retirement.

Look for mentorship programs or organizations that match mentors with individuals who need guidance. These could be programs at local schools, universities, non-profit organizations, or institutions that focus on career development or entrepreneurship.

Becoming a mentor after retirement is a great way to give back to the community and empower the next generation. There is more an individual satisfaction to be felt when utilizing your experience and knowledge to help others reach their full potential.

2. Participate in Social Projects

Retirement gives you the opportunity to get more involved in social projects that benefit the community. Look for social projects or non-profit organizations that match your interests and values. You can look for local projects in your community, join an organization whose mission aligns with what you support, or look for online opportunities to contribute globally.

You can also volunteer at a charity, help out at a social service site, or even contribute to programs that combat social inequality. Remember that giving back to society is a great way to use your free time in a positive way and make a real impact on the world also people around surround you.

5. Gardening and Nature Activities

Developing a hobby of gardening and nature activities after retirement, you can not onlycan help you enjoy the beauty of nature, but also maintain your physical and mental health. Gardening also gives you the opportunity to interact with nature directly and feel the deep satisfaction of seeing your plants grow and thrive.

Having a vegetable garden or flower garden not only gives you the satisfaction of seeing the results but also provides an opportunity to exercise and connect with the nature. It is no wonder that gardening and nature can be a productive activity for retirees.

Start by deciding on a space where you can garden. This could be your home garden, a pot on your patio or balcony, or even a local community garden. Next, schedule regular time in your week to tend to the plants and do activities in the garden.

7. Develop a Small Business

If you have an interest in running a business, then developing a small business after retirement is an exciting step and can provide great satisfaction in staying productive.

Examine your skills, knowledge and experience from your previous working life. Identify and look for business ideas that match your interests, skills and experience. Consider starting a business in an industry you are familiar with or an area you have been interested in. Business ideas can come in many various kinds, started vary from consulting, professional services, to retail or online businesses.

Developing a small business after retirement is an exciting and meaningful step. By utilizing your skills and experience, and remaining open to learning and innovation, you can create a successful small business that brings great satisfaction in the next stage of your life.
